That's a great tip!! Was the cooler anything special? Or just a regular old Igloo, etc.?Many years ago we caught a bunch of fish in Canada. They quik froze them. We took an empty cooler. put a layer of newspaper on the bottom. We then wrapped every frozen filet in newspaper.,put one layer of fish then one layer of newspaper then one layer of fish untill we got to the top. last layer newspaper. closed the top and duct tape it closed note: no ice or dry ice. it took us 3 days to drive home all of the fish were still frozen solid!! GeniusHere is a trick for the anchovies, buy a small cooler at a garage sale for a dollar. put the anchovies wrapped in newspaper in the cooler on ice. Put the little cooler in your big cooler. After about 3 days when the cooler starts to stink throw the whole cooler in the trash. Dennis j from Junction
